Low Water Pressure Impact on Boilers
Low water pressure can significantly affect the performance of your boiler, leading to inadequate heating and hot water supply. Understanding how water pressure influences boiler function is crucial for effective troubleshooting. This section will explore the relationship between low water pressure and its impact on your heating unit’s efficiency.
Low water pressure can prevent your boiler from heating water effectively. This issue can arise from various factors, including blockages in the pipes or leaks in the system.
Steps to Fix Low Water Pressure:
Inspect the pressure gauge on the boiler. It should read between 12-15 psi when cold.
Check for leaks in the system by examining visible pipes and joints.
Clear any blockages in the pipes by flushing the system.
If the pressure remains low after these steps, consider consulting a professional for further inspection.

Expansion Tank Function and Faults
Understanding the role of the expansion tank is crucial when addressing issues with your heating unit, especially if you’re experiencing a lack of hot water. This component helps manage pressure within the system, and any faults can lead to significant heating problems. Identifying these issues can be the first step toward restoring your boiler’s efficiency.
A faulty expansion tank can cause the boiler to cycle frequently, leading to inadequate hot water. This tank absorbs excess pressure in the system and helps maintain consistent water temperature.
Steps to Check the Expansion Tank:
Inspect the tank for leaks or visible damage.
Check the air pressure in the tank using a pressure gauge. It should typically be set to 12 psi.
Replace the tank if it is waterlogged or damaged.
A properly functioning expansion tank is crucial for maintaining consistent hot water supply.
